#define red_ipin 23
#define green_ipin 22
#define blue_ipin 21
#define yellow_ipin 19
#define red_lpin 26
#define green_lpin 27
#define blue_lpin 14
#define yellow_lpin 12
void setup() {
// put your setup code here, to run once:
Serial.begin(115200);
Serial.println("Hello, ESP32!");
pinMode(red_ipin, INPUT);
pinMode(green_ipin, INPUT);
pinMode(blue_ipin, INPUT);
pinMode(yellow_ipin, INPUT);
pinMode(red_lpin, OUTPUT);
pinMode(green_lpin, OUTPUT);
pinMode(blue_lpin, OUTPUT);
pinMode(yellow_lpin, OUTPUT);
digitalWrite(red_lpin, LOW);
digitalWrite(green_lpin, LOW);
digitalWrite(blue_lpin, LOW);
digitalWrite(yellow_lpin, LOW);
}
void loop() {
// put your main code here, to run repeatedly:
digitalWrite(red_lpin,digitalRead(red_ipin));
digitalWrite(green_lpin,digitalRead(green_ipin));
digitalWrite(blue_lpin,digitalRead(blue_ipin));
digitalWrite(yellow_lpin,digitalRead(yellow_ipin));
// delay(10); // this speeds up the simulation
}
